Well it looks like Instagram might lose its popularity. They have cut ties with Twitter by not allowing a direct link to the instagram photo.
Now if someone posts an intagram link to twitter, the link will take them to Instagram app or website.
This could be good or bad. I see that they are trying to keep Instagram as a social network, but once Twitter adds photo filters it might become useless.
